The city will (hopefully) unveil its term sheet with Mark Mastrov and Ron Burkle on Thursday, then hold three public workshops on the plan before the City Council votes on March 26.

The city announced on Friday that three public workshops will be held to give residents and business owners an opportunity to review the term sheet currently being developed by city manager John Shirey and potential Kings owners Mark Mastrov and Ron Burkle. In addition to the "unveiling" of the term sheet at City Hall on Thursday at 5:30 p.m. -- where the public will be invited to comment and ask questions -- the city will hold public workshops at:

* The Robertson Center on Norwood on March 22 from 5:30-7:30 p.m.

* The Pannell Center on Meadowview on March 23 from 9-11 a.m.
